Skip to content
drm fixes for v6.14-rc4

core:
- remove MAINTAINERS entry

cgroup/dmem:
- use correct function for pool descendants

panel:
- fix signal polarity issue jd9365da-h3

nouveau:
- folio handling fix
- config fix

amdxdna:
- fix missing header

xe:
- Fix error handling in xe_irq_install
- Fix devcoredump format

i915:
- Use spin_lock_irqsave() in interruptible context on guc submission
- Fixes on DDI and TRANS programming
- Make sure all planes in use by the joiner have their crtc included
- Fix 128b/132b modeset issues

msm:
- More catalog fixes:
- to skip watchdog programming through top block if its not present
- fix the setting of WB mask to ensure the WB input control is programmed
  correctly through ping-pong
- drop lm_pair for sm6150 as that chipset does not have any 3dmerge block
- Fix the mode validation logic for DP/eDP to account for widebus (2ppc)
  to allow high clock resolutions
- Fix to disable dither during encoder disable as otherwise this was
  causing kms_writeback failure due to resource sharing between
  WB and DSI paths as DSI uses dither but WB does not
- Fixes for virtual planes, namely to drop extraneous return and fix
  uninitialized variables
- Fix to avoid spill-over of DSC encoder block bits when programming
  the bits-per-component
- Fixes in the DSI PHY to protect against concurrent access of
  PHY_CMN_CLK_CFG regs between clock and display drivers
- Core/GPU:
- Fix non-blocking fence wait incorrectly rounding up to 1 jiffy timeout
- Only print GMU fw version once, instead of each time the GPU resumes